What I don't like:

• Chargers might be the only team in the NFL with a more talented roster than the Vikings. And they're 5-8. Go figure. But this is not the same team it was earlier in the season, when a lot of that talent was banged up and Rivers playing like shit. 

• Ingram and Bosa vs. Reiff and O'Neill. Not a huge mismatch, but definitely advantage Chargers. 

* Casey Heyward and Derwin James vs. Diggs, Rudy and Smith. Hayward is one of the best corners in the league and James was 1st team all pro as a rookie last year. What's more, Chargers play a zone. Diggs eat free against man. Not zone.  

• Gordon and Ekeler vs. Vikings run defense. Vikings run defense ranks high statistically, but I don't really trust it. Gordon and Ekeler are better than Carson and Penny. If the Chargers get up early, this could get ugly. 

What I like:

• Cook and Boone vs. Chargers run defense. If the Chargers defense is vulnerable anywhere, it's against the run. League average. If the Vikings can stay balanced and not get behind early, they should be able to break off some chunk runs to keep the Chargers on their heels. 

• Adam Thielen vs. zone. Before I really looked into this game I didn't realize how important Thielen would be. Diggs is a guy who plays better vs. man. And I wish I had stats to back this up, but I know that Thielen is a big time zone beater. He just has a knack for finding those holes in zones. If he can stay healthy, I love him in this game. 

• Keenan Allen and Mike Williams vs. Alexander and Rhodes. Call me crazy but I like this matchup. Allen plays in the slot 53% of the time and so unless they move him around a lot, he'll draw Mack Alexander, who is playing better for us than anyone right now. If Rhodes has a strength it's slowing big, physical receivers and that's what Mike Williams is. Allen, too, actually. Allen hasn't had 100 yards since week 3.

• Hunter vs. Sam Tevi and Philip Rivers. I remember being very impressed with Tevi in the Shrine game a couple of years ago. A sort of poor man's Brian O'Neill, he's very athletic. Took over for an injured Joe Barksdale and never gave up the job. But he'll need his big boy britches in this one. Griffen and Okung will likely play to a draw, but I like the Vikings pass rush to get to Ol' Man Rivers. 

Vikings 17
Chargers 15
